Objective: To provide the experience on medical rgscue and care for any giant earthquake by analysing the Patients treated by the Chinese Medical Rescue Team in the Barakott earthquake of Pakistan.Methods: On October 8,2005,a giantearthquake(7.8Richter scale)earthquake occurred in the northwest Pakistan.Wle belonged to the Chinese Medical Rescue Team and worked in the earthquake-affected town-Bardkott from October28,2005 to November17,2005.The Patients wcre classifted into upper respiratory tract infection,diarrhea,trauma and other diseases.All the data of patients who were in jured during the earthquake were analysed.The difference was analyzed by X2 test.Results: Of the 2194 patients treated by the Chinese Medical Rescuc Team.trauma patients only accounted for 29%,diarrhea patients for 4%,upper respiratory infection patients for 14%.and Other types of diseases for 52%.Among the 630 trauma patients,426 patients were injured during the earthquake.Of the 426 patients,291(68%)patients were found having open wounds,85(20%)patients mainly complained of soft tissue pain without any wound orfracture,and76(18%)patients had fractures with or without open wound.The most frequent site of wound was lower extremity.Head injury in children was 30%,obviously higher than that in the adults.Wound infection Was common among the injured patients,with the rates of 72%,64%and 78%in male,female adult patients and children,respectively.Conclusions: Prcvalence of common diseascs,trauma,wound infection and fracture are main problems presented at late stage of the giant earthquake.Great attention should be paid to head and lower extremity injuries.
